Biology 1: Fundamentals of Biology
This online, interactive Biology class is an
introductory course designed to survey the principles of biology. Cell
theory, cell division, heredity, evolution and ecology, anatomy and
physiology of plants and animals, and the classification system are
included.
Students work independently at their own pace. A student
lounge will be available for student chat. Science databases will be
discussed in order for students to access up-to-date research and
information on a variety of topics as they pertain to this course.
